Nous offrons \u00e9galement des remises sur les thermopompes \u00e0 air et g\u00e9othermiques pour rendre votre mise \u00e0 niveau plus abordable.<\/p>\n\n\n\n<h2 class=\"wp-block-heading has-text-align-center\">THERMOPOMPES \u00c0 AIR ET G\u00c9OTHERMIQUES<\/h2>\n\n\n\n<div class=\"wp-block-columns is-layout-flex wp-container-core-columns-is-layout-9d6595d7 wp-block-columns-is-layout-flex\">\n<div class=\"wp-block-column is-layout-flow wp-block-column-is-layout-flow\">\n<h3 class=\"wp-block-heading has-text-align-center is-style-hero-heading-grey\">THERMOPOMPES G\u00c9OTHERMIQUES<\/h3>\n\n\n\n<div style=\"height:10px\" aria-hidden=\"true\" class=\"wp-block-spacer\"><\/div>\n\n\n\n<figure class=\"wp-block-image size-large is-resized\"><img loading=\"lazy\" decoding=\"async\" width=\"1024\" height=\"576\" src=\"https:\/\/efficiencymb.ca\/wp-content\/uploads\/GSHP-banner-image-1024x576.jpg\" alt=\"Heat pump being installed\" class=\"wp-image-19120\" style=\"width:400px\" srcset=\"https:\/\/efficiencymb.ca\/wp-content\/uploads\/GSHP-banner-image-1024x576.jpg 1024w, https:\/\/efficiencymb.ca\/wp-content\/uploads\/GSHP-banner-image-479x269.jpg 479w, https:\/\/efficiencymb.ca\/wp-content\/uploads\/GSHP-banner-image-768x432.jpg 768w, https:\/\/efficiencymb.ca\/wp-content\/uploads\/GSHP-banner-image-1536x864.jpg 1536w, https:\/\/efficiencymb.ca\/wp-content\/uploads\/GSHP-banner-image-2048x1152.jpg 2048w, https:\/\/efficiencymb.ca\/wp-content\/uploads\/GSHP-banner-image-1920x1080.jpg 1920w\" sizes=\"auto, (max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n\n\n\n<p>Une thermopompe fait circuler du liquide dans une boucle de tuyaux enfouis sous terre. En mode chauffage, le liquide absorbe la chaleur de la terre, qui reste \u00e0 une temp\u00e9rature stable. La chaleur est extraite du liquide et achemin\u00e9e dans votre maison. En \u00e9t\u00e9, la chaleur est redistribu\u00e9e dans le sol.<\/p>\n\n\n\n<h4 class=\"wp-block-heading is-style-hero-heading\">Avantages :<\/h4>\n\n\n\n<ul class=\"wp-block-list is-style-small\">\n<li>Assure le chauffage et le refroidissement<\/li>\n\n\n\n<li>Solution de chauffage \u00e0 faibles \u00e9missions de carbone<\/li>\n\n\n\n<li>Id\u00e9ale pour les grands terrains et les espaces ouverts<\/li>\n\n\n\n<li>R\u00e9duit d\u2019une proportion allant jusqu\u2019\u00e0 60 % vos frais de chauffage \u00e9lectrique<\/li>\n<\/ul>\n\n\n\n<p><a href=\"https:\/\/efficiencymb.ca\/fr\/articles\/tout-savoir-sur-les-thermopompes-geothermiques\/\" target=\"_blank\" rel=\"noreferrer noopener\">Apprenez-en davantage sur les thermopompes g\u00e9othermiques dans notre article!<\/a><\/p>\n<\/div>\n\n\n\n<div class=\"wp-block-column is-layout-flow wp-block-column-is-layout-flow\">\n<h3 class=\"wp-block-heading has-text-align-center is-style-hero-heading-grey\">THERMOPOMPE<br>\u00c0 AIR<\/h3>\n\n\n\n<div style=\"height:10px\" aria-hidden=\"true\" class=\"wp-block-spacer\"><\/div>\n\n\n\n<figure class=\"wp-block-image size-large is-resized\"><img loading=\"lazy\" decoding=\"async\" width=\"1024\" height=\"576\" src=\"https:\/\/efficiencymb.ca\/wp-content\/uploads\/air-source-heat-pump-GettyImages-1328873462-scaled-e1662039283306-1024x576.jpg\" alt=\"Air heat pumps beside house\" class=\"wp-image-20494\" style=\"width:400px\" srcset=\"https:\/\/efficiencymb.ca\/wp-content\/uploads\/air-source-heat-pump-GettyImages-1328873462-scaled-e1662039283306-1024x576.jpg 1024w, https:\/\/efficiencymb.ca\/wp-content\/uploads\/air-source-heat-pump-GettyImages-1328873462-scaled-e1662039283306-479x269.jpg 479w, https:\/\/efficiencymb.ca\/wp-content\/uploads\/air-source-heat-pump-GettyImages-1328873462-scaled-e1662039283306-768x432.jpg 768w, https:\/\/efficiencymb.ca\/wp-content\/uploads\/air-source-heat-pump-GettyImages-1328873462-scaled-e1662039283306-1536x864.jpg 1536w, https:\/\/efficiencymb.ca\/wp-content\/uploads\/air-source-heat-pump-GettyImages-1328873462-scaled-e1662039283306-2048x1152.jpg 2048w, https:\/\/efficiencymb.ca\/wp-content\/uploads\/air-source-heat-pump-GettyImages-1328873462-scaled-e1662039283306-1920x1080.jpg 1920w\" sizes=\"auto, (max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n\n\n\n<p>Un compresseur fait circuler le r\u00e9frig\u00e9rant, qui absorbe et lib\u00e8re de la chaleur entre l\u2019\u00e9quipement int\u00e9rieur et ext\u00e9rieur. En hiver, la chaleur est tir\u00e9e de l\u2019air ext\u00e9rieur pour r\u00e9chauffer votre maison. En \u00e9t\u00e9, le syst\u00e8me tire la chaleur de l\u2019int\u00e9rieur de la maison et la transf\u00e8re \u00e0 l\u2019air ext\u00e9rieur.<\/p>\n\n\n\n<h4 class=\"wp-block-heading is-style-hero-heading\">Avantages :<\/h4>\n\n\n\n<ul class=\"wp-block-list is-style-small\">\n<li>Assure le chauffage et le refroidissement<\/li>\n\n\n\n<li>Facile \u00e0 moderniser avec votre infrastructure existante<\/li>\n\n\n\n<li>R\u00e9duit d\u2019une proportion allant jusqu\u2019\u00e0 30 % vos frais de chauffage \u00e9lectrique<\/li>\n<\/ul>\n\n\n\n<p><a href=\"https:\/\/efficiencymb.ca\/fr\/articles\/tout-sur-les-thermopompes-a-air\/\" target=\"_blank\" rel=\"noreferrer noopener\">Apprenez-en davantage sur les thermopompes \u00e0 air dans notre article!<\/a><\/p>\n<\/div>\n<\/div>\n\n\n\n<h2 class=\"wp-block-heading has-text-align-center is-style-hero-heading-grey\">Prochaines \u00e9tapes<\/h2>\n\n\n\n<p>Avant de mettre \u00e0 niveau votre syst\u00e8me de chauffage, il est judicieux de rendre votre maison aussi \u00e9co\u00e9nerg\u00e9tique que possible.
